Canton of Saint-Jean-de-Braye
The canton of Saint-Jean-de-Braye is an administrative division of the Loiret department, in central France.[1] Its borders were modified at the French canton reorganisation which came into effect in March 2015. Its seat is in Saint-Jean-de-Braye.[1] The population of the canton as of 1 January 2018 is 39,328.[2]
It consists of the following communes:[1]
- Boigny-sur-Bionne
- Bou
- Chécy
- Combleux
- Mardié
- Saint-Jean-de-Braye
- Semoy
